U.S. Supreme Court Ruling on Enhanced Sentences for Repeat Offenders

Earlier this morning, the United States Supreme Court ruled on the following case that affects the entire nation as relates to enhanced sentencing for repeat offenders:

The United States Supreme Court has just issued a final ruling on Enhanced Sentences for Repeat Offenders and it reads as follows: SCOTUS Ruling on Repeat Offender Enhanced Sentences is 8-1: 11-9540, Descamps. Per Kagan. The modified categorical approach does not apply to statutes that contain a single indivisible set of elements. In Plain English, it is now harder for the government to use the facts of a prior conviction to enhance a federal criminal sentence. The decision of the court of appeals against the defendant is reversed.
